  • Palace of the Shirvanshahs - Built in the 15th century, the Shirvanshah Palace in Baku served the rulers of Shirvan after the capital moved from Shemakha to Baku. The complex includes the palace, tomb, mosque, divanhane, mausoleum of Sayyid Yahya Bakuvi, bath, eastern portal, and the gate of Murad (16th century). The main palace building, started in 1411 by Shirvanshah Sheikh Ibrahim I and continued by his son Khalilullah I, features a unique design with about fifty rooms connected by narrow spiral staircases. The ground floor, used by servants and for storage, remains as it was in the 15th century. The facade facing the front yard is more austere compared to other buildings. Near the palace is a mosque with an inscription under the minaret’s stalactite belt. The Divan-Khane, used for ambassador receptions and meetings, is one of Azerbaijan’s most beautiful architectural monuments. Declared a museum in 1964, the complex is a popular tourist site.
  • Miniature Books - Located in the old city, the Museum of Miniature Books holds the Guinness World Record for the largest collection of miniature books. Created by Zarifa Salahova over 30 years, the museum opened on April 2, 2002, and features over 5,600 books from 66 countries. Entrance is free.
  • Juma Mosque - Built on the ruins of ancient pagan buildings, the Juma Mosque in Icheri-sheher has been functioning since the 12th century. Funded by Baku philanthropist Khadja Shikhali Dadashev in 1899, the mosque was built on the site of a fire worshipers’ temple. The mosque’s conical dome, supported by four central pillars, is of special interest.
